Common questions about gmc repair services in Cedarville, CA
Given Cedarville's rural setting and variable terrain, common issues include suspension wear from rough roads, brake system maintenance due to mountainous driving, and cooling system checks for summer temperatures. Diesel-specific problems in models like the Sierra 2500/3500 are also frequent due to their popularity for local ranch and hauling work.

You should have the 4WD system serviced before winter to ensure reliability for Modoc County's snowy roads and muddy ranch paths. Listen for unusual noises when engaged and address any warning lights immediately, as consistent use on uneven terrain can lead to wear on transfer cases and front differential components.
Always mention if your vehicle is used heavily for hauling livestock, trailers, or farm equipment, as this stresses the drivetrain. Also, discuss your typical routes, such as frequent travel on dusty backroads to Alturas or sustained highway driving, as these conditions dictate specific maintenance needs for air filters, tires, and fluids.
